Optimal design method of sealing depth in methane drainage boreholes to realize efficient drainage

Abstract: The purpose of underground methane drainage technology is to eliminate methane disasters and enable the efficient use of coal mine methane (CMM). The sealing depth is a key factor that affects the underground methane drainage performance. In this work, the layouts of bedding and crossing boreholes were considered to analyze the stress distribution and failure characteristics of roadway surrounding rocks through a numerical simulation and field stress investigation to determine a reasonable sealing depth.
